Summary
The July 2009 Beacon announced three free public trips from Beaver Island’s Ferry Dock aboard the W. G. Jackson research vessel on July 29. The trips were presented as part of a Lake Michigan outreach program involving water sampling, exhibits, public input, and lake-management education.
Evidence limits
This is a planned visit announcement; it does not establish passenger counts, sampling results, or completion of the visit.
